用于Web开发的高功率设备与大多数用户访问在线内容的更适中的设备之间存在很大的差异。网站越来越大,复杂,进一步加剧了这个问题。
解决方案?在低规格笔记本电脑上测试您的网站或Web应用程序。
这些预算笔记本电脑的处理能力有限,并且通常是预装的资源密集型软件,代表了用户群的很大一部分。它们很普遍,不会很快消失。
测试时,请注意:
基于这些观察,制定了补救计划。
目前,CSS-Tricks的用户群主要利用功能强大的现代台式机,笔记本电脑,平板电脑和带有更新的操作系统和充足处理能力的手机。
CSS-Tricks的受众群体并不代表所有Web开发人员,但对普遍的行业实践提供了宝贵的见解。这些设备通常吹嘘:
不幸的是,这些规格并不是所有用户中的通用。
第一次世界大战的英国士兵最初配备了毛毡或皮头盔,过渡到Brodie头盔,Brodie头盔旨在防止头部受伤。引入后,士兵的头部受伤急剧增加。但是,这种增加反映了以前本来是致命的伤害生存率的提高。这说明了生存偏见 - 仅将成功浏览选择过程的人(在这种情况下为生存)。同样,网站分析仅反映了成功加载和使用内容的用户,忽略了那些经历较差性能并放弃网站的用户。
网站分析不会捕获由于性能问题而无法加载或使用您的网站的用户。尽管存在复杂的分析,但他们通常无法说明加载部分网站但由于用户体验差而离开的用户。
在低规格的笔记本电脑上进行测试可以突出性能瓶颈,但根本原因通常在于:
解决这些问题需要将绩效考虑因素整合到更广泛的业务策略中。
实施定期的性能测试,也许将其集成到现有的可用性测试中,为现实世界用户体验提供了宝贵的见解。与利益相关者分享这些发现可以有效地证明绩效问题对用户参与度的影响。
专用设备进行常规测试。大多数开发工具都与低规格的机器兼容,从而实现了现实的性能评估。如果任务大大减慢,则突出了优化的需求。
至关重要的是,避免仅将低规格设备等同于经济劣势。无论社会经济地位如何,各种因素都可以导致使用较低的技术。无论设备或情况如何,所有人都应访问高性能,用户友好的网站。
以上是在糟糕的笔记本电脑上测试您的产品的详细内容。更多信息请关注PHP中文网其他相关文章!